Titus, Roberts finish tied for eighth at state
Nov 20, 2008
Irvine Valley golfers Felicia Titus and Samantha Roberts tied for the eighth best score at the State Championships, which wrapped up on Tuesday at Olivas Links in Ventura.
The two IVC players just missed out on all-state recognition. That went to the top six individuals.
Titus, who was the Orange Empire Conference player of the year, shot scores of 80 and 80 at the two-day tournament. Roberts, who along with Titus led IVC to its second ever team conference title, shot 81 and 79.
"It was a good ending to a great season," IVC coach Ben Burnett said. "I think that the experience gained by Felicia and Samantha will result in Irvine Valley competing for the 2009 state title."
Santa Barbara came from behind after day one to win the state team title. Sacramento City placed second and Palomar, which was the stroke leader after day one, took third.
